What Foods Are Rich in Vitamin A? Top Sources & Benefits

Close up of carrots with water dropletsClose up of carrots with water droplets

While the idea that carrots grant superhuman night vision is a bit of a myth, they do contain a valuable nutrient, beta-carotene, which our bodies convert into vitamin A. This conversion process is why carrots, with their vibrant orange hue, are indeed beneficial for vision, particularly in low-light conditions. Vitamin A plays a critical role in supporting overall eye health, and its benefits extend far beyond just eyesight. It is essential for stimulating white blood cell production, aiding bone remodeling, maintaining healthy endothelial cells that line our body’s surfaces, and regulating cell growth crucial for processes like reproduction.

Vitamin A exists in two primary forms in our diet: preformed vitamin A (retinol and retinyl esters) and provitamin A carotenoids (like alpha-carotene and beta-carotene). Preformed vitamin A is sourced from animal products, fortified foods, and supplements. Provitamin A carotenoids are naturally found in plant-based foods. It’s worth noting that not all carotenoids convert to vitamin A; some, like lycopene, lutein, and zeaxanthin, offer their own unique health advantages.

Recommended Daily Intake of Vitamin A

Understanding how much vitamin A you need is crucial. Nutritional labels currently list vitamin A in International Units (IU). However, health organizations like the Institute of Medicine use micrograms (mcg) of Retinol Activity Equivalents (RAE) for Recommended Dietary Allowances (RDAs). This shift to mcg RAE accounts for the varying absorption rates of preformed and provitamin A. The Food and Drug Administration (FDA) is also transitioning to using “mcg RAE” on food and supplement labels.

  • Recommended Dietary Allowance (RDA): For adults aged 19 and older, the RDA is 900 mcg RAE for men (3,000 IU) and 700 mcg RAE for women (2,333 IU).
  • Tolerable Upper Intake Level (UL): The safe upper limit for daily vitamin A intake from retinol is 3,000 mcg. Exceeding this could lead to adverse health effects.

Health Benefits of Vitamin A-Rich Foods

Consuming a diverse diet rich in vitamin A, especially through fruits and vegetables, is linked to protection against various diseases. The benefits from vitamin A supplements, however, are less conclusive and require careful consideration.

Cancer Prevention

Lung Cancer: Studies have shown that higher intakes of carotenoids from fruits and vegetables are associated with a reduced risk of lung cancer, particularly in non-smokers and former smokers. However, clinical trials using beta-carotene and vitamin A supplements have not replicated these protective effects and, in some cases, have shown an increased risk of lung cancer in smokers taking these supplements. Health organizations advise against high-dose beta-carotene and retinyl palmitate supplements, especially for smokers and those exposed to asbestos.

Prostate Cancer: Lycopene, a carotenoid responsible for the red color in tomatoes and grapefruit, has garnered attention for its antioxidant properties and potential role in cancer prevention. While studies on lycopene and prostate cancer are ongoing, some research suggests that diets rich in lycopene, particularly from tomatoes, may offer some protection against prostate cancer. However, due to variations in lycopene content in food and the presence of other beneficial compounds in these foods, definitive conclusions about lycopene’s specific impact are still being investigated.

Cognitive Function

Research into the MIND diet, focused on preventing neurodegenerative decline, has highlighted the link between vitamin A and cognitive health. Higher blood levels of alpha-carotene, which includes lutein and zeaxanthin, were associated with improved cognitive functions like memory and attention in individuals at risk of cognitive decline. Foods contributing to these higher alpha-carotene levels include fruits, leafy greens, and orange vegetables, emphasizing the importance of including these vitamin A rich foods in your diet for brain health.

Age-Related Vision Diseases

Age-related Macular Degeneration (AMD): AMD is a leading cause of vision loss in older adults. Oxidative stress and poor dietary habits are considered risk factors. Lutein and zeaxanthin, carotenoids found in the retina, have antioxidant properties that may protect against AMD. The Age-Related Eye Disease Studies (AREDS and AREDS2) have shown that high-dose supplements including vitamins C and E, along with lutein and zeaxanthin, can slow the progression of intermediate and late-stage AMD, particularly in those with low dietary carotenoid intake. Beta-carotene, however, was not found to be protective in these studies, highlighting the importance of specific carotenoids like lutein and zeaxanthin for eye health.

Top Food Sources of Vitamin A

Many foods are excellent sources of vitamin A, either preformed or as provitamin A carotenoids. Fortified foods also contribute to vitamin A intake.

  • Vegetables:

    • Leafy Greens: Kale, spinach, collard greens, and other leafy greens are packed with beta-carotene.
    • Orange and Yellow Vegetables: Carrots, sweet potatoes, pumpkin, butternut squash, and other winter squashes are renowned for their high beta-carotene content. Summer squash also contributes.
    • Tomatoes and Red Bell Peppers: These are good sources of lycopene and beta-carotene.
  • Fruits:

    • Cantaloupe and Mango: These fruits offer a delicious way to boost your vitamin A intake through carotenoids.
  • Animal Sources:

    • Beef Liver: Liver is an exceptionally rich source of preformed vitamin A (retinol).
    • Fish Oils: Cod liver oil and other fish oils are significant sources of preformed vitamin A.
    • Dairy Products: Milk and cheese, especially whole milk varieties, contain preformed vitamin A.
    • Eggs: Egg yolks provide preformed vitamin A.
  • Fortified Foods: Many breakfast cereals, juices, and dairy alternatives are fortified with vitamin A, often in the form of retinyl palmitate. Check nutrition labels to identify fortified options.

Vitamin A Deficiency and Toxicity

Maintaining a balanced vitamin A intake is key, as both deficiency and toxicity can lead to health issues.

Vitamin A Deficiency

While vitamin A deficiency is uncommon in developed countries, certain conditions can increase the risk, including digestive disorders like celiac disease and Crohn’s disease, liver cirrhosis, alcoholism, and cystic fibrosis, which can impair vitamin A absorption. Individuals with very restricted diets due to poverty or self-imposed limitations are also at risk.

Signs of mild deficiency may include:

  • Fatigue
  • Increased susceptibility to infections
  • Infertility

More severe deficiency can manifest as:

  • Xerophthalmia: Severe eye dryness that can lead to blindness if untreated.
  • Nyctalopia (Night Blindness): Difficulty seeing in low light.
  • Bitot’s Spots: Irregular patches on the whites of the eyes.
  • Dry Skin and Hair

Vitamin A Toxicity

Vitamin A toxicity is more likely to occur from excessive intake of preformed vitamin A, often from high-dose supplements. Because vitamin A is fat-soluble, excess amounts are stored in the body, potentially reaching toxic levels.

Symptoms of vitamin A toxicity can include:

  • Vision changes, such as blurred vision
  • Bone pain
  • Nausea and vomiting
  • Dry skin
  • Sensitivity to bright light

It’s important to note that beta-carotene from plant sources is not associated with toxicity, as the body regulates its conversion to vitamin A. This further emphasizes the safety and benefits of obtaining vitamin A from whole foods.

Did You Know?

  • Cod Liver Oil Caution: While cod liver oil is often taken for vitamin D, it’s extremely high in preformed vitamin A. If you take cod liver oil, be mindful of your overall vitamin A intake from other supplements to avoid exceeding the safe upper limit.
  • Topical Vitamin A in Skincare: Concerns about vitamin A (retinol or retinyl palmitate) in sunscreens and moisturizers causing toxicity or cancer are largely unfounded. Topical vitamin A is poorly absorbed into the bloodstream and unlikely to contribute to systemic toxicity. While retinoids can increase skin sensitivity to sunlight, applying these products at night and using sun protection during the day mitigates this risk.
